Manchester City today announced the signing of Kieran ‘Kez’ Brown, a professional FIFA player. Kez becomes the first eSports player in the Manchester City organisation, and will be creating video content for the City YouTube channel and streaming on Twitch. Blizzard has filed a lawsuit against German company Bossland, the creator of Watchover Tyrant, which is a cheating tool for Overwatch. The publisher is accusing Bossland of copyright infringement, unfair competition, and violating the DMCA’s anti-circumvention provision,” TorrentFreak reports.
